At Goldman Sachs, our Engineers don’t just make things – we make things possible. Change the world by connecting people and capital with ideas. Solve the most challenging and pressing engineering problems for our clients. Join our engineering teams that build massively scalable software and systems, architect low latency infrastructure solutions, proactively guard against cyber threats, and leverage machine learning alongside financial engineering to continuously turn data into action. Create new businesses, transform finance, and explore a world of opportunity at the speed of markets.
Engineering, which is comprised of our Technology Division and global strategists groups, is at the critical centre of our business, and our dynamic environment requires innovative strategic thinking and immediate, real solutions. Want to push the limit of digital possibilities? Start here.
The Opportunity
We own, evolve and support the technology platforms that handle the post-execution processing for the Securities Execution, Prime Clearing, and Prime Brokerage businesses. This includes exchange and broker trade processing, internal firm/firm trades and client delivery across physical and synthetic products. We are at the start of a multi-year convergence program to deliver all of these businesses onto a single, high scalable platform, enabling business growth with reduced operational costs.
We’re looking for highly technical, commercially minded, software engineers who enjoy seeing things done differently to join us on this exciting journey.
About the team
Our team consists of 19 people in Singapore and around 100 globally. Almost all of our projects are cross-location and cross-function, meaning we work directly with Front Office, Operations, Legal, Tax, and our Engineering colleagues from those areas, across the wider firm.
We work directly with Operations and Securities sales/trading, to design and implement, a wide range of functions including trade aggregators, trade matchers, payment systems, intercompany trade booking and settlement systems, and connectivity to exchanges, counterparties and vendors. Our Exception Workflow and Business Intelligence tooling allows our Operations teams to respond to client enquiries and monitor service levels.
Our Post Execution platform consists of a variety of applications that demand high throughput, performance and availability, including our strategic new Post Execution Sequencer platform which is a brand new/greenfield initiative to converge all of our businesses onto a single technology platform, to have much better scalability, improved resiliency and reducing the time needed to develop and deliver new features.
Highly-developed analytical and technical skills, combined with a commercial and collaborative approach to problem solving, are essential to our success.
HOW YOU WILL FULFILL YOUR POTENTIAL -
You Will:
- Use your analytical ability and decision-making skills to arrive at creative and user-oriented solutions.
- Work with key stakeholders, operations, and other development teams delivering scalable exception-monitoring solutions to our middle office teams.
- Drive the architectural design and technical execution of the engineering needs of the equities businesses.
- Take responsibility for project delivery as well as wider ownership in our functional area.
- Design and build frameworks including automated testing through collaboration with global cross-functional teams.
You Are:
- Strong Full-stack developer enjoys working in a client driven and agile environment passionate in implementing customizable user interfaces.
- Self-motivated and able to work in small, fast-paced, high-impact team(s) developing low latency, scalable and resilient solutions.
- Comfortable multi-tasking, managing multiple stakeholders and working as part of a global team.
- Apply an entrepreneurial approach and passion to problem solving and product development.
SKILLS & EXPERIENCE WE'RE LOOKING FOR –
Basic Qualifications
- 5+ years of responsive web development, with professional React hooks experience and advanced JavaScript / Typescript proficiency.
- Experience with grid-based layouts, eg. ag-grid and flexible layouts.
- Solid experience in and strong desire on building highly efficient and performant UI code
- Building web socket-based (and/or REST API) integration with server-side.
- Desire to build strong and efficient SDLC practices.
- Systematic problem-solving approach, coupled with a hands-on experience of debugging and optimizing code, as well as automation.
- Strong interpersonal skills and drive. Excellent communication skills required, able to contribute to discussions on design and strategy
Preferred Qualifications
- 1+ years of experience with Java or similar object oriented language (e.g. C++, C#, Scala, Python).
- Financial market knowledge is a plus
- Experience leading/managing a small team of developers